区块链转账解密:私钥、公钥与交易安全!

区块链的私钥是非常重要的,千万不要泄漏!!!

私钥/公钥概述

  • 我们在和智能合约交互或者我们需要转账的时候,都需要授权。这些都是要用到私钥和公钥的。
  • 我们用私钥授权签名,然后用公钥验证这个签名是否是通过私钥签署的。这样主要是为了确保转账信息不会被篡改。
  • 我们的钱包被盗,有些是因为私钥被盗,或者私钥乱授权,导致资产损失。

私钥/公钥工作原理

  • 我们通过椭圆曲线数据签名算法可以随机生成私钥和公钥。私钥是授权交易,公钥是验证这个交易是否是私钥授权的。
  • 私钥是用来授权签名的,所以私钥千万不要泄漏。公钥是提供给别人转账的,所以是可以公开的。
  • 在使用的过程中,我们用私钥来签名,然后用公钥验证这个签名是否合法。公钥验证这个签名如果是从私钥发出的。那么通过验证。
  • 如果你的消息签名又任何的误差,那么用公钥就无法验证通过,因为这个签名不是私钥签署的。这样就无法进行交易。
  • 加密货币的地址我们可以看作是一个公钥。我们把转账的数据通过私钥来进行授权签名。然后通过公钥来验证这个交易是否是私钥签署的,确认无误之后,那么我们就可以进行转账了。
  • 我们的区块链转账的时候,都需要使用私钥来授权签名的。如果任何的内容被篡改了,那么区块链就无法验证这个交易。区块链就放弃这币交易。

总结

私钥的授权签名是非常重要的,很多小伙伴就是因为私钥乱授权导致资产被盗的。所以一定要非常谨慎授权每一步交易。

相关视频:https://youtu.be/IbNNjMXkc0w

以下是我用过的交易所,有需要的小伙伴欢迎使用我的邀请连接来注册,你的支持是我最大的创作动力!